Preparation Techniques Explained
Transforming nervous energy into a beneficial force begins long before the interview itself. We can leverage our enthusiasm and anxiety by employing awareness techniques and breath exercises. By engaging in mindfulness, we acknowledge our feelings and thoughts, enabling us to control them rather than be overwhelmed. Basic exercises, like concentrating on our breath, can assist stabilize us in the existing moment. A few intense, leisurely breaths can lower our heart rates, calm our minds, and channel that jittery energy into lucidity and concentration. Integrating these practices into our everyday routine equips us for stressful situations. With consistent practice, we’ll discover that we not only calm our nerves but also boost our ability come interview day.
